Wing Haven Gardens & Bird Sanctuary
Since 1927, one of Charlotte's special attractions, created by Elizabeth and Edwin Clarkson, has been a 3-acre enclosed area in the heart of a residential neighborhood. Mrs. Clarkson was known as the city's "bird lady." Some 142 winged species have been sighted in the walled garden, which was once a bare clay field. Birders and garden lovers will have a field day as they browse through the Upper, Lower, Main, Wild, Herb, and Rose gardens. The gardens are at their most splendid in the spring, when birds are returning from their winter migration. A bulletin board tells you which birds are around at the moment.
Mint Museum of Art
With the recently added Dalton Wing, this stately museum displays a fine survey of European and American art, as well as the internationally recognized Delhom Collection of porcelain and pottery. Also featured are pre-Columbian art, contemporary American prints, African objects, vast collections of costumes and antique maps, and gold coins originally minted at the facility. New galleries exhibit studio glass and pottery from North Carolina studios. An admission ticket also gains you admittance to the Mint Museum of Craft & Design (220 N. Tryon St.).
Discovery Place & the Nature Museum
Discovery Place is one of the top hands-on science and technology museums in the region. This uptown center features such permanent exhibits as a tropical rain forest and an aquarium. There's also an OMNIMAX theater. The static-electricity demonstration, which literally makes your hair stand on end, is a perennial favorite. Temporary exhibits on loan from other science centers keep the place forever changing.
